Why hvac companies struggle with SEO
Emergency repair pages often carry the same hero slider as the homepage, delaying first contentful paint on mobile.
Seasonal service pages (AC tune-up, furnace repair) frequently share near-identical copy and compete with each other.
Maintenance-plan and financing pages are commonly orphaned with no internal links pointing at them.
What we typically find on hvac companies sites
- Render-blocking slider or booking script above the fold
- Near-duplicate seasonal service pages competing for the same query
- Orphan pages with zero internal links
- Missing LocalBusiness schema and service-area markup
- Mobile tap targets under 48px on the primary call CTA
How we check this
Nothing on this page is estimated. When you submit a URL the audit engine fetches the live page and runs the same probes on every site — the list above is simply the subset that fails most often on hvac companies sites.
- Server-side HTML fetch: title, meta description, headings, canonical, hreflang, robots directives and internal links are parsed from the response body.
- Google PageSpeed Insights: Core Web Vitals (LCP, CLS, INP) and the mobile render, pulled from the free public API.
- Structured data: every JSON-LD, microdata and RDFa block is parsed and checked for the types this industry needs.
- Crawlability: robots.txt rules, sitemap presence and reachability, HTTPS and certificate validity, and a sampled internal-link check for 404s.
